WebBreastfeeding: Assists the uterus to return to its pre-pregnant state faster. Can help women to lose weight after baby’s birth. May reduce the risk of mothers with gestational diabetes developing type 2 diabetes. Reduces the risk of ovarian cancer and pre-menopausal breast cancer. May reduce the risk of osteoporosis. WebJan 19, 2024 · The majority of Australian women (96%) initiate breastfeeding however rates of exclusive breastfeeding dramatically decline in the following months with only 39% of infants being exclusively breastfed by aged three months [1, 2, 11, 12]. While intention and initiation of breastfeeding is high among women at a population level, some … WebJun 17, 2024 · Most (95.9%) children aged 0-3 years received breast milk. One in three (35.4%) were exclusively breastfed to 6 months. More than half (54.2%) were introduced to solids at 6 months or later. The National Health Survey 2024-21 was collected online during the COVID-19 pandemic and is a break in time series.

WebThis is how domperidone will help with your milk supply. Domperidone is the most effective medicine used to improve breast milk supply. It was developed to treat nausea, vomiting, indigestion and gastric reflux, but has been found to be effective when used to increase milk supply.
